Circle K Thirst Buster 64oz DIY Cup Holder

I use my 64oz Circle K cup a lot at work, for water and Gatorade (haven't put soda in it for a year.) but it's awkward trying to keep it in place on a golf cart, and almost impossible to keep it upright in the van. So, I added a holder to the cart (see picture) made from a 6" S&D PVC pipe cap. The cap is exactly the right size to hold the cup.

I also made one for the van, but had to figure out a way to keep it from falling over and sliding around the van. (Many wet accidents with that cup!) Hence the 10 lb. weight and Velcro feet.

It cost about $10.00 for the weight, $6.00 for the cap and $5.00 for the bolts and other hardware. Which sounds a bit steep for a cup holder, but it was a fun project and serves a good purpose for me.

I've spent the last week using the weighted version on the front seat of a golf cart where I work.  In spite of the sometimes rough paths and bumpy roads, it has stayed in place holding the cup without any problem or spills.

... and no, I don't know if there's a cap that will hold the 100oz size Circle K cup...
